@ManagedObject public class MonitoredQueuedThreadPool extends QueuedThreadPool
A QueuedThreadPool
subclass that monitors its own activity by recording queue and task statistics.

@ManagedOperation(value="resets the statistics", impact="ACTION") public void reset()
@ManagedAttribute(value="the number of tasks executed") public long getTasks()
@ManagedAttribute(value="the maximum number of busy threads") public int getMaxBusyThreads()
@ManagedAttribute(value="the maximum task queue size") public int getMaxQueueSize()
@ManagedAttribute(value="the average time a task remains in the queue, in nanoseconds") public long getAverageQueueLatency()
@ManagedAttribute(value="the maximum time a task remains in the queue, in nanoseconds") public long getMaxQueueLatency()
@ManagedAttribute(value="the average task execution time, in nanoseconds") public long getAverageTaskLatency()
@ManagedAttribute(value="the maximum task execution time, in nanoseconds") public long getMaxTaskLatency()
